Slate roof leak repair services involve identifying and fixing leaks that occur in slate roofing systems. Skilled contractors perform thorough inspections to locate the source of water intrusion, which may be caused by cracked, broken, or missing slate tiles, as well as damaged flashing or deteriorated underlayment. Once the problem areas are pinpointed, they carefully replace or repair individual slate pieces, ensuring the roof maintains its integrity and aesthetic appeal. This process helps prevent further water damage, mold growth, and structural issues that can arise from persistent leaks.

Many problems can be addressed through slate roof leak repair services, including cracked or broken tiles, loose or missing slates, and compromised flashing around chimneys, vents, or dormers. Over time, exposure to weather elements can cause slate tiles to crack or shift, creating vulnerabilities that allow water to seep into the building. Repairing these issues promptly can help protect the interior from water damage, prevent wood rot, and avoid costly repairs to the underlying roof structure. Regular maintenance and timely repairs are especially important for older slate roofs, which may be more susceptible to damage.

The overview below groups typical Slate Roof Leak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typically, minor leak repairs on slate roofs cost between $250 and $600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, covering small cracks or damaged tiles. Costs can vary depending on the extent of the damage and accessibility.

Moderate Repairs - More extensive repairs, such as replacing several damaged tiles or sealing larger sections, usually range from $600 to $1,500. These projects are common and often involve addressing multiple problem areas on the roof.

Major Repairs - Larger, more complex repairs like patching extensive leaks or reinforcing sections of the roof can cost between $1,500 and $3,500. Fewer projects fall into this tier, typically involving significant damage or difficult access issues.

Full Roof Replacement - Replacing an entire slate roof generally ranges from $10,000 to $30,000 or more, depending on the size and complexity of the roof. This is a less common scenario, usually reserved for older roofs with widespread damage or deterioration.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of a slate roof leak? Signs include water stains on ceilings or walls, missing or damaged slate tiles, and the presence of mold or mildew in attic spaces.

Can a leaking slate roof be repaired without replacing the entire roof? Yes, many leaks can be addressed through targeted repairs such as replacing damaged slates or sealing vulnerable areas, avoiding the need for full roof replacement.

What types of repairs do local contractors typically perform for slate roof leaks? Repairs often involve replacing broken or missing slates, sealing flashing and joints, and fixing any underlying issues that cause water intrusion.

Is it necessary to inspect a slate roof regularly for leaks? Regular inspections can help identify potential issues early, preventing more extensive damage and ensuring the roof remains in good condition.

How do contractors determine the cause of a slate roof leak? Contractors assess the roof’s condition, look for damaged or displaced slates, check flashing and seals, and examine attic spaces to identify the source of water intrusion.
